Our take

Petitgrain and lemon open the fragrance with a brisk, sunlit citrus that feels clean rather than sharp. Lavender adds a soft herbal touch that keeps the start from leaning too tart. The first impression is fresh and inviting, suitable for a morning routine or a casual walk outside.

Green bell pepper sits at the center and gives the scent a crisp, slightly bitter edge. Cedar brings a dry woodiness that steadies the brighter notes. This stage feels more grounded than the opening, moving the composition toward a garden path after rain.

Sandalwood and patchouli form a creamy, earthy foundation that defines the drydown. Amber and vanilla add a golden warmth that wraps around the woods without becoming sugary. The base feels smooth and slightly powdery, with a balsamic depth that lingers close to the skin.

The overall character is woody, aromatic, and gently green. It suits someone who enjoys a classic fougere structure with a modern, resinous finish. The final impression is a warm spicy accord that feels comforting and composed.
